Re: [WTB] Left side axle shaft
axles are easy to rebuild....
Remove the broken boot, clean the axle using rags and solevents, and reinstall a new boot. Good as new. If it doesn't click or anything yet, I'd just rebuild it.
then again, if you can find one local, it might be worth your time.
